      Global Peripheral Arterial Disease Market to be USD 8.25 Bn, 2032

      Published Date: Oct 2025


      The global peripheral arterial disease market, valued at USD 5.14 Billion in 2025, is projected to exhibit a CAGR of 7.0%, reaching USD 8.25 Billion by 2032.

      Market growth is primarily driven by the increasing prevalence of peripheral arterial disease among aging populations, rising incidence of cardiovascular risk factors such as diabetes, hypertension, and obesity, and growing awareness of early diagnosis and intervention. Advancements in minimally invasive endovascular procedures, innovative pharmacological therapies, and combination treatment approaches are further fueling the market expansion.

      Additionally, supportive healthcare infrastructure, improved reimbursement policies, and enhanced investment in clinical research aimed at improving patient outcomes are expected to sustain the market growth over the forecast period.

      Market Takeaways

      • By Treatment, Drug Therapy (including antiplatelets and anticoagulants) is expected to dominate the peripheral arterial disease market with a 55.3% share in 2025, driven by their proven efficacy in improving blood flow, reducing the risk of clot formation, and inclusion in standard treatment protocols for managing peripheral arterial disease.
      • By Disease, Peripheral Arterial Disease itself is projected to lead the market with a 60.2% share in 2025, attributed to its higher prevalence compared with other vascular conditions, growing awareness of early diagnosis, and increased focus on timely intervention to prevent complications such as critical limb ischemia.
      • By Patient Type, the Adult segment is anticipated to account for the largest share in 2025, supported by the high incidence of peripheral arterial disease among adults with cardiovascular risk factors, lifestyle-related comorbidities, and the rising adoption of preventive and therapeutic interventions.
      • Regionally, North America is expected to hold the largest market share in 2025, backed by advanced healthcare infrastructure, high prevalence of cardiovascular diseases, strong reimbursement policies, and ongoing clinical research focused on novel peripheral arterial disease therapies and minimally invasive procedures.

      Market Dynamics

      The global peripheral arterial disease market is experiencing steady growth, driven by the rising prevalence of peripheral arterial disease and other vascular disorders among adult and elderly populations, increasing awareness about cardiovascular health, and advancements in pharmacological and interventional therapies. Early diagnosis through routine cardiovascular screenings, primary care check-ups, and public health awareness campaigns is facilitating timely treatment, which is critical for improving patient outcomes and preventing severe complications such as critical limb ischemia and amputation.

      Innovations in treatment approaches are reshaping the market, with developments in novel antiplatelet and anticoagulant therapies, minimally invasive endovascular interventions, and combination treatment strategies enhancing efficacy and patient adherence. Drug therapies such as antiplatelets and anticoagulants remain widely used, while emerging therapies targeting vascular remodeling, inflammation, and thrombosis prevention are gaining traction. Endovascular interventions, including balloon angioplasty and stenting, are increasingly integrated with pharmacological treatments for holistic management.

      Hospitals, specialized cardiovascular care centers, and outpatient clinics continue to be the primary end users, supported by trained healthcare professionals, advanced infrastructure, and access to multidisciplinary treatment programs. Telemedicine platforms and remote monitoring devices are emerging as growth avenues, enabling broader patient reach, real-time follow-up, and adherence to therapy outside traditional clinical settings.

      Despite the positive outlook, market growth faces challenges such as patient non-compliance, delayed diagnosis due to asymptomatic cases in early stages, high procedural and therapy costs, and limited access to specialized care in developing regions. However, ongoing product innovation, expanded public health initiatives, and increased clinical research investments are expected to sustain market momentum through 2032.

      Market Trends

      • Growing Emphasis on Preventive Care and Lifestyle Modifications

      There is a growing focus on preventive care and lifestyle modifications in managing peripheral arterial disease. Healthcare providers are promoting non-invasive approaches such as supervised exercise programs, tailored diets, and structured smoking cessation as first-line therapies to improve symptoms, walking ability, and quality of life. These strategies help manage the disease effectively while reducing cardiovascular risks and limb-related complications. This shift toward patient-centered, non-pharmacological care is influencing treatment paradigms, expanding peripheral arterial disease management beyond traditional drug or surgical interventions, and emphasizing long-term lifestyle improvements for better clinical outcomes.

      • Integ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I) in Diagnosis and Treatment Planning

      Artificial Intelligence (AI) is increasingly being utilized to enhance the diagnosis and treatment planning for peripheral arterial disease. AI algorithms are being developed to analyze medical imaging data, predict disease progression, and assist in personalized treatment strategies. This integration aims to improve diagnostic accuracy and optimize patient outcomes.

      In October 2022, researchers at Stanford University developed an automated tool to identify undiagnosed peripheral arterial disease cases. This tool, tested using a digital dashboard, aims to bring potential peripheral arterial disease cases to doctors’ attention, enhancing early detection and treatment planning.

      Market Opportunities

      • Integration of Telemedicine and Remote Patient Monitoring

      The increasing adoption of telemedicine and remote monitoring solutions is creating new opportunities in the management of peripheral arterial disease. Wearable devices, mobile health apps, and connected monitoring platforms allow continuous tracking of patient symptoms, blood flow, and exercise compliance. This facilitates early intervention, timely adjustments to therapy, and improved adherence to lifestyle modifications and pharmacological treatments. By enabling healthcare providers to remotely manage patients, reduce hospital visits, and personalize care plans, these digital health solutions are expected to enhance patient outcomes and expand the reach of peripheral arterial disease care, driving the market growth over the forecast period.

      • Expansion of Minimally Invasive Treatment Options

      The growing adoption of minimally invasive procedures, such as angioplasty, stenting, and atherectomy, is transforming the management of peripheral arterial disease. These approaches offer patients significantly reduced recovery times, lower risk of complications, and improved overall outcomes compared to traditional surgical interventions. As clinicians increasingly prefer less invasive techniques, demand for these advanced peripheral arterial disease treatments is rising, creating substantial growth opportunities for medical device manufacturers and healthcare providers focusing on endovascular solutions.

      Key Developments

      • In August 2021, The Janssen Pharmaceutical Companies of Johnson & Johnson announced that the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) had approved an expanded peripheral artery disease (PAD) indication for the XARELTO (rivaroxaban) vascular dose (2.5 mg twice daily plus aspirin 100 mg once daily) to include patients following recent lower-extremity revascularization (LER) due to symptomatic PAD.
